Category: Appetizers, Sides & Snacks
    Prep Time:       Cook Time:       Total Time:   1/2 hr

2 lbs fresh green beans, trimmed
1 Tbsp olive oil, or as needed
1 tsp kosher salt
½ tsp freshly ground black pepper


1. Preheat the oven to 400 degrees..
2. Rinse green beans and pat dry with paper towels; spread onto a rimmed baking sheet. Drizzle beans with olive oil, then season with salt and pepper. Use your hands to toss the beans until evenly coated with oil; spread out in a single layer.
3. Roast in the preheated oven until beans are crisp-tender, look slightly shriveled, and start to show golden caramelized spots, 15 to 25 minutes.
